A Window Into a Niche Audience -- and Their Credentials

Taipei.ru occupied a specific cultural niche: a Russian-language portal for travelers and expatriates interested in Taiwan's capital. The platform's user base wasn't large by mainstream standards, but it was definitionally narrow -- Russian speakers with a demonstrated interest in Taipei, enough to register on a dedicated portal. When the database surfaced on August 26, 2018 with 39,073 records and plaintext passwords, it exposed not just credentials but a detailed demographic snapshot of a highly specific cross-cultural comunity.


Taipei.ru (August 2018): Breach Summary

  • Records Exposed: 39,073
  • Data Types: Usernames, email addresses, plaintext passwords
  • Breach Type: Database breach
  • Password Hash Type: Plaintext (fully compromised)
  • Country Affected: Russia
  • Date Leaked: August 26, 2018

Plaintext Passwords: Immediate, Total Exposure

Plaintext password storage means there is no security layer between database access and credential use. The 39,073 Taipei.ru accounts weren't protected by hashing, salting, or any form of encryption -- the passwords were readable directly from the database. This means any attacker who obtained the database had immediate access to a complete, ready-to-deploy credential list. Russian-language platforms tend to have high cross-platform reuse rates, with users sharing credentials across VKontakte, Odnoklassniki, Yandex services, and other regional platforms. Taipei.ru credentials thus served as a potential master key for a much broader digital footprint.


What Registration on Taipei.ru Reveals

Niche tourism and expat platforms carry unique data value beyond the credentials themselves. A user registered on Taipei.ru is statistically likely to have travel history to or interest in Taiwan, potential language skills, and connections to both Russian-speaking and Taiwanese communities. In a geopolitical context where Russian-Taiwanese contacts have particular sensitivity, a verified list of Russian nationals with demonstrated Taipei interest has intelligence value beyound credential stuffing. Whether the August 2018 breach was exploited for intelligence purposes is unknown -- but the demographic specificity of the platform's user base makes it more sensitive than a general-purpose breach of comparable size.


The August 26, 2018 Multi-Site Disclosure Event

Taipei.ru's data was disclosed alongside databases from Germany, Japan, Thailand, USA, Indonesia, and Austria on August 26, 2018 -- a coordinated batch release spanning at least seven countries and multiple industries within a 48-hour window. This simultaneous multi-site disclosure pattern is consistent with bulk data brokerage: a threat actor accumulates databases from diverse sources over time, then releases them together to establish credibility, build dark web reputation, or clear aging inventory. The August 26 cluster represents one of the more geographically diverse coordinated disclosures of that period.
